What to know when choosing a school in Surat Thani

The ranking holds 9 schools with an international accreditation or an authorised programme. The British Cambridge route, IGCSE and A-Level, at 6. A year of school costs from $5 989 to $19 603. A swimming pool on site is confirmed at 1.

Private schools in Surat Thani

All 9 schools in the ranking are private. We have not yet found a state school in Surat Thani with an international accreditation. The type of school does not affect the score: private and state schools sit in one list and are scored by the same formula, and only verifiable data moves the number.

Schools with IB and Cambridge programmes in Surat Thani

The British Cambridge programme - IGCSE and A-Level - is taught at 6 schools in Surat Thani: PBISS International School, Windfield International School, International School of Samui, Greenacre International School, Balance International School Suratthani, Unicorn British International School (U-BIS).

Best schools in Surat Thani: ranked on data anyone can check

1PBISS International SchoolSchool in the registers of Cambridge, ACS WASC, Pearson≈ $7 711–14 195 a year · 255 500–470 340 THB · Pre-School from 2 years77.38/9 criteria2Windfield International SchoolSchool in the register of CambridgePart of the network Windfield International SchoolPrice on request · Pre-School from 2 years75.77/9 criteria3International School of SamuiSchool in the registers of Pearson, Cambridge≈ $13 770–19 603 a year · 456 252–649 514 THB · Pre-School from 3 years73.38/9 criteria4Greenacre International SchoolSchool in the register of Cambridge≈ $5 989–8 511 a year · 198 450–282 000 THB · Pre-School from 3 years72.98/9 criteria5Suratthani International SchoolSchool in the register of CogniaPrice on request · Pre-School from 2 years71.27/9 criteria6Balance International School SuratthaniSchool in the register of CambridgePrice on request · Pre-School from 2 years70.25/9 criteria7Unicorn British International School (U-BIS)School in the register of CambridgePrice on request67.17/9 criteria8Daniel International SchoolMembership of ACSI≈ $9 296–13 859 a year · 308 000–459 200 THB · Pre-School from 2 years60.98/9 criteria9SCL International SchoolSchool in the register of PearsonPrice on request60.97/9 criteria

Facilities at schools in Surat Thani

A facility counts only when the school names it outright on its own site: a modern campus is not a swimming pool. Swimming pool: 1 school · Boarding: 1 school · School transport: 2 schools.

Frequently asked questions

How much does an international school in Surat Thani cost?

Published fees run from $5 989 to $19 603 for a school year. The cheapest is Greenacre International School, the most expensive International School of Samui. The median for the senior stage is $13 859 a year. Fees are converted into dollars at a weekly rate; schools publish them in their own currency.

Which school in Surat Thani ranks first?

PBISS International School comes first with 77.3 points out of 100, counted from 8 of the 9 criteria. Next come Windfield International School (75.7) and International School of Samui (73.3). The score is built from data anyone can check: accreditations found in official registers, programmes, facilities and published fees. A place in the ranking is not for sale.

How many private and state schools with an international programme are there in Surat Thani?

The ranking holds 9 schools: 9 private. We found no state school in Surat Thani with an international accreditation. Private and state schools go into the ranking on equal terms.

Where in Surat Thani can a child follow the British Cambridge programme?

IGCSE and A-Level are offered by 6 schools: PBISS International School, Windfield International School, International School of Samui, Greenacre International School, Balance International School Suratthani, Unicorn British International School (U-BIS).

From what age do international schools in Surat Thani take children?

The earliest intake starts at 2 years old. 7 schools have a preschool section.
